Transaction 269c6a065a8d5a5b320dfc9be3fea2f2ebd29dcffd1a89bb0ea80a8aa29f2b64
1 Input
1 Output
-
269c6a065a8d5a5b320dfc9be3fea2f2ebd29dcffd1a89bb0ea80a8aa29f2b64:0
- value
- 689743
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3da1960e8d11ea3758bed89a97dc1e719642e00
- address
- bc1q70dpjc8g6y02xavtaky6jlwpuuvkgtsqh4cklz